Why each option
802.11r (Fast BSS Transition) is the standard protocol designed to minimize re-authentication latency during roaming, which is critical for voice quality.
WPA2-PSK is an authentication and encryption mode, not a roaming optimization protocol, and its full 4-way handshake during each roam introduces latency that disrupts voice calls.
802.11r defines the Fast BSS Transition mechanism, which pre-caches key material with target APs before a client roams, reducing the roaming handoff from hundreds of milliseconds to under 50 ms. This latency reduction is essential for VoWLAN because call quality degrades when roaming delays exceed approximately 150 ms.
TKIP is a legacy RC4-based encryption protocol deprecated by 802.11n and later standards and provides no mechanism to accelerate or optimize the roaming process.
WEP is a broken and deprecated encryption scheme that provides neither adequate security nor any fast-roaming capability.
